7. An unknown amine X has the molecular formula C8H₁7N. Treatment of amine X with excess CH31 followed by Ag₂O and heat afford only a mixture of two isomeric unknown amines Y and Z, each with the molecular formula C9H19N (indicating one DUS). Treatment of the mixture of Y and Z with excess CH3l, Ag₂O and heat afforded the following dienes along with N(CH3)3: 从从 -1 Unknown amine X has only four peaks in its 13C NMR spectrum and no peaks greater than 3000 cm-¹ in its IR spectrum. What are the structures of X, Y and Z?
